- 返回时间差
- Java.util.Date类
- toString()
- getTime()
- JDK8中新日期时间API
- 获取当前的日期或时间
- 指定日期或时间
- 获取指定的字段
- 设置相关属性
- DateTimeFormatter类
该方法用来返回当前时间与1970年1月1日0时0分0秒之间以毫秒为单位的时间差。
可以用来计算时间差。
public static long currentTimeMills()Java.util.Date类
Date date1 = new Date(); scout(date1.toString());toString()
显示当前的年月日时分秒
getTime()获取当前Date对象对应的毫秒数(时间戳)
JDK8中新日期时间API 获取当前的日期或时间LocalDate localDate = LocalDate.now(); LocalTime localTime = LocalDate.now(); LocalDateTime localDateTime = LocalDateTime.now();指定日期或时间
LocalDateTime.of(2020,10,6,13,23,24); //年月日时分秒获取指定的字段
System.out.println(localDateTime.getDayOfMonth()); System.out.println(localDateTime.getDayOfWeek()); System.out.println(localDateTime.getMonth()); System.out.println(localDateTime.getMonthValue()); System.out.println(localDateTime.getMinute());设置相关属性
LocalDateTime localDateTime2 = localDateTime.withHour(4);DateTimeFormatter类



